Project Management in Children's Games Development: Project management plays a crucial role in the development of children's games. It involves planning, organizing, and executing tasks to ensure the successful delivery of a game project. By using project management methodologies such as Agile or Scrum, developers can break down the game development process into manageable tasks, set milestones, and collaborate effectively with team members. This approach helps to streamline the development process, improve efficiency, and deliver high-quality games on time. Data Hashing for Secure Gameplay: Data hashing is a crucial aspect of security in children's games. It involves converting sensitive information, such as passwords or personal data, into a unique string of characters using an algorithm. By hashing data, developers can ensure that user information is protected from unauthorized access or tampering. In children's games, where privacy and safety are paramount, data hashing plays a vital role in safeguarding personal information and providing a secure gameplay experience for young players. Implementing Data Hashing in Children's Games: To implement data hashing in children's games, developers can use secure hashing algorithms such as SHA-256 or bcrypt. By incorporating data hashing techniques into the game's login system, developers can securely store user credentials and protect sensitive information from potential security breaches. Additionally, regular encryption updates and security audits can help to maintain the integrity of data hashing mechanisms and ensure a safe gaming environment for children.
